Transaction 818fe26cd9701c9fa1bb5317f12e3507448f3deb42aeb77ce25dad0c375633f7

1 Input
1 Outputs
  • 818fe26cd9701c9fa1bb5317f12e3507448f3deb42aeb77ce25dad0c375633f7:0
  • value  14408094
    address  18dVYGZznjqKoXq2N5Hw5gP5Nd73hoKCr5